Brash Higgins Shiraz 2021

Brash’s 2021 SHZ is a deep, brooding Shiraz from the organically farmed Omensetter Vineyard—25-year-old vines planted on red clay over limestone, giving the wine its signature depth and rustic flair.

Fermented wild with 25% whole bunches and left on skins for 3 weeks, the wine was basket pressed and aged for 20 months in French hogsheads (15% new). The result is a structured, intensely savoury red that avoids the usual sweet-fruited Shiraz tropes.

Expect black plum, blood orange and paprika, woven through with earth, crushed herbs and smoky spice. There’s grip and grit here—fine tannins and a meaty, elemental quality that speaks of site and hands-off winemaking.

“A good douse of whole-bunch spice, with a wee dab of rusticity… Fine tannins, a gritty carapace lathered with spice.” – Ned Goodwin MW – James Suckling
